Hello,

I am tryin to make secure ftp connection to a host, but TC PB3 can not do this. I have this log:

Code: Select all

--------
Connect to: (<date>)
hostname=<somehost>
user=<someuser>
startdir=/
<somehost>=<someip>
220 .
AUTH TLS
530 Please login with USER and PASS.
AUTH SSL
530 Please login with USER and PASS.
QUIT
Old FS plugin for TC6 connects to this host normally, WinSCP program too. Is it possible to make TC connect successfully?

Hi,
No, only FTPS is supported internally, not SFTP.

Sorry, SFTP and FTPS are very different from each other. There is no OpenSFTP library which I could use.
